Man gets death penalty for fire killing

Published: May 12, 2008 at 11:17 PM
Order reprints
ORLANDO, Fla., May 12 (UPI) -- A Florida man has been sent to death row after being found guilty of killing his girlfriend by setting her on fire, officials said.

Dane Abdool, 21, was convicted of pouring gasoline on Amelia Sookdeo, 17, and setting fire to her body in February 2006, the Orlando (Fla.) Sentinel reported.

The jury then recommended to Orange Circuit Court Judge Lisa Munyon that Abdool be given the death sentence.

A 12-member jury found Abdool guilty of first-degree murder in December and decided 10-2 Sunday he should be executed, the Sentinel reported.

The Department of Corrections said Abdool will be among the youngest people to be on death row.
